𝅘𝅥𝅯 My journey into technology started with earnings from my fourbouys paper round. with the help of my grandfather and paperound I bought a Mesh Computers next gen originally with a 40GB hard drive, 1.4ghz CPU costing £1,440 new. That was the only machine I would buy outright as I built everything else myself as you would expect from an Electronic Engineering HND student who has done 4 years of a Computer science study. Whilst studying for an HND in Electronic Engineering whilst spending my breaks in the colleges library computer lab I realised I had a knack and enthusiasm for computer tech.
𝅘𝅥𝅯 in the attic Lab I had an 8 way VGA splitter a very cool piece of kit even with crts it looked awesome. from left to right two huge cardboard boxes used to deliver 2/8 17inch DEll CRT monitors, HP4000N with duplux unit. www.lan (Apache HTTPD on debian Linux ), www2.lan (apache HTTPD on CentOs Linux), spare Beige chassis underneath Desk, 4 port KVM placed just beneath new widescreen dell 17inch (I think) TFT (Thin Film Transistor) screen, dev.lan ubuntu Linux box used for java development using netbeans JDK j2ee tomcat(the lnux with the best specced hardware of the machines shown here, q6600 intel (quad CPU, this was a super CPU and still lives toda=y just not used just now) 8GB of RAM at least one 1TB Root Partition) machine was also used for ripping DVD's to avi or mp4 using ogmrip. also used for, next of the black chassis is the db1.lan (mysql server OpenSuse Linux), the big chassis at the end was the original home for the Abit BP6 motherboard that I recently posted shared a video about on my Facebook page. very cool Motherboard. the next desk housed the NAS.lan and ftp.lan, can't remember which linux Distro was used but might have been Debian or some flavour of Debian. used MDAM for software raid 5 using 4 * 1TB in a nice big ANTEC chassis also ran ProFTP to host FTP. there was a epson inkjet just in case. at the bottom is a 16 way network switch in case I needed more. I would often plug laptop into this when I needed to check laptop network card. My J2EE dev Examples are currently available on port 8282 with the stable/production on port 8080. currently have a login servlet for with mysql backend. I also use php as frontends for the mysql backend. Two hosts serve the Tomcat and HTTPD servers one is debian the other Linux Mint (ubuntu) load balanced with haproxy. I didn't originally intend to host site with mysql backend as I thought for a site with no submitted info/data and just hosting my thoughts/Cv and other streamed content that I wouldn't need a ssl cert but soon discovered that since I last hosted my own site firefox has made ssl/TLS Certs a requirement. With my various efforts at creating a self signed certifacates not working or not being accepted by hiring managers work proxies I have settled on using lets encrypt. I have certs for mail.skdj.co.uk skdj.co.uk www.skdj.co.uk khaleeq.skdj.co.uk (placeholder for hosting friends Website) and cameron.skdj.co.uk which is a side project I started when I thought I might need to negotiate for my next car bill.
